Dotson Ice Shelf (USA) 74° 24' 00.0" S 112° 22' 00.0" W Ice shelf
Name ID: 124463 Place ID: 3803

An ice shelf about 30 mi wide between Martin and Bear Peninsulas on the coast of Marie Byrd Land. First mapped by USGS from air photos obtained by USN Operation HighJump in January 1947. Named by US-ACAN for Lt. William A. Dotson, USN, formerly Officer in Charge of the Ice Reconnaissance Unit of the Naval Oceanographic Office, killed in a plane crash in Alaska in November 1964 while on an ice reconnaissance mission.
